Output 74d8baa030a29786f788524a8f7901561bef4b58d51cf643747eb0a5d55fa201:0

value
16516289
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 76e807d16fe01bec0aca10e5ae5bb9554ff974edae218d98acda9d10550bc0e8
address
bc1pwm5q05t0uqd7czk2zrj6ukae248lja8d4cscmx9vm2w3q4gtcr5q0p3mke
transaction
74d8baa030a29786f788524a8f7901561bef4b58d51cf643747eb0a5d55fa201
confirmations
128229
spent
true